titleOfInvention | Multi-purpose physiological detecting device and system |
abstract | The present invention relates to a multi-purpose physiological detecting device and system. In one embodiment, the multi-purpose physiological detecting device includes a physiological signal capturing unit having two electrical contact areas and a light sensor, and a wearable structure. The physiological signal extraction unit is combined with a body part of the user to obtain electrophysiological signals and/or blood physiological related information. |
